What "emergency treatment" indicates in practice
Most individuals picture a plaster or an ice bag. In training, you relocate much previous that. The core of emergency treatment is choice making under pressure. You find out to scan for danger, assign functions, and work a systematic key survey so you do not miss out on time‑critical problems. You will practice the DRSABCD method, which is the criterion in Australia, and you will certainly do it with a manikin on the floor, not simply in a workbook.
On the first day of a strong Tuggerah first aid program you can expect to handle a simulated collapse outside a coffee shop. You will certainly look for threats like traffic or broken glass, telephone call triple absolutely no, roll an individual right into the healing setting, and start CPR if they are not breathing. The trainer will include practical curveballs. The patient might vomit. A relative might stress. You learn to constant yourself, utilize short expressions, and maintain the rhythm at 100 to 120 compressions per minute.
Beyond resuscitation, first aid training in Tuggerah typically covers choking, anaphylaxis, bronchial asthma, extreme bleeding, fractures, back preventative measures, seizures, diabetic person emergencies, stroke acknowledgment, shock, burns, and standard wound treatment. Excellent trainers will weave in neighborhood context. For instance, they will certainly speak about bites and stings located around Tuggerah Lake and the coastal strip, and regarding heat stress on summer sporting activity days.

What top quality looks like in Tuggerah first aid training
I have viewed thousands of people come through emergency treatment and cpr training Tuggerah programs. The ones who leave confident share a few patterns.
First, the trainer has actual field experience. You can feel it in the stories. Rather than dull slides, you listen to a tugboat deckhand describing a smashed finger, or a surf lifesaver describing how a child's breathing adjustments in the first minute of a close to drowning. When you vet a service provider, ask about instructor backgrounds, not just certifications held.
Second, manikin time is charitable, and comments specifies. For mouth-to-mouth resuscitation, look for manikins with compression deepness sensing units. A green light at 5 to 6 centimeters, a red light when you bounce. You desire that truthful feedback, since genuine chests fight you. A carrier that turns manikins and decontaminates appropriately between trainees is taking your security seriously.
Third, scenarios are paced well. In some class, you get a battery of impractical emergencies piled back to back. Good Tuggerah first aid training will decrease to isolate abilities initially, then layer complexity. You will practice one‑rescuer mouth-to-mouth resuscitation, then two‑rescuer with a bag shutoff mask, after that include an AED with sticky pads that entangle if you do not believe ahead.
Finally, the admin is crisp. Registration, verification e-mails, pre‑course job, place maps, and certificates ought to arrive without chasing. If a carrier messes up the basics prior to you appear, consider how they will deal with assessment records if your employer audits them.

The day of your course
Arrive 10 mins early. Places near Tuggerah station are practical however can be tight on vehicle parking throughout weekday business hours. Bring government‑issued ID, water, and clothes you can kneel and lean ahead in. If you use a skirt or tight denims, the kneeling part will certainly be uncomfortable, and you will invest your time adjusting as opposed to focusing on upper body recoil.
Trainers in the area are normally punctual. They will certainly check eLearning completion, take a fast roll, and set the tone. Disturbances are the enemy of good compressions. Put your phone away. You will certainly begin with hazards and the primary survey, after that relocate quickly to hands‑on CPR. It is normal to really feel weary after your initial 2 minutes of compressions. That is the factor. You will certainly discover to exchange rescuers efficiently every 2 minutes to keep deepness and rate.

AEDs used in Tuggerah classes mirror what you will discover in shopping center and sporting activities clubs. You will practice using pads around a bra band without losing time, shaving an upper body if required, and standing clear prior to a shock. Fitness instructors will certainly remind you that you do not stop compressions to turn the AED on. You maintain pushing while your companion opens and applies. If your program consists of infant and youngster mouth-to-mouth resuscitation, you will practice with smaller sized manikins, adjusting compression deepness and hand placement.
Scenario job follows. A normal sequence could consist of a choking grownup in a food court setup, a suspected back injury after a skateboard loss near the station, or an extreme asthma assault during a lunchtime five‑a‑side game. You will certainly trainer your partners with inhaler strategy, action shortness of breath by their capability to talk full sentences, and monitor feedback to medication.
For bleeding, you will certainly roll plasters that actually compress an injury rather than simply cover it. Fitness instructors will reveal you where tourniquets belong in the kit and when to utilize them. You will certainly not be asked to improvisate a tourniquet from a shoelace, since that functions improperly and creates injury. If the class covers burns, you will stress amazing running water for 20 minutes rather than lotions that catch heat.
If your program includes anaphylaxis, you will certainly practice with EpiPen instructors until your thumb locates the correct end every time. In a genuine occasion, adrenaline drinks your hands. Muscular tissue memory keeps you from firing the wrong way.
Assessment is useful. You will certainly demonstrate series without notes. Speak up loud during your checks. It assists you, and it indicates to the assessor that you know the order.

What an office first aid rollout looks like
If you manage a group in Tuggerah, strategy your emergency treatment and cpr courses Tuggerah rollout like any kind of various other conformity job. Begin with a threat analysis. Map headcount, shift patterns, and the threats distinct to your website. Retail settings gain from more AED‑savvy personnel on weekends. Storage facilities require additional blood loss control capacity and recognition of crush injuries. Early childhood centres require HLTAID012 coverage across all shifts.
Decide your target proportion of experienced staff per shift. Several offices go for one to 2 assigned very first aiders per 25 individuals on website, scaling up where threats are greater. Surprise training dates so you do not end up with the whole feedback ability running out in the exact same month. Ask your service provider for a training matrix export so you can calendar suggestions 2 months ahead of each certificate expiry.
On the day of training, draw your first aid packages out for the practical session. Instructors will certainly detect ended EpiPens, level torch batteries, missing triangular bandages, or AED pads that no longer stick. Construct a tiny budget plan line for consumables. You will make use of a couple of throughout drills, which is fine. Much better to re‑stock now than throughout an incident.
The AED landscape around Tuggerah
Public access defibrillators are extra common around the Tuggerah area than they were 5 years earlier. Shopping center, sporting activities clubs, and some bigger retailers maintain AEDs near customer service workdesks. You will discover in class exactly how to send out a runner to fetch one while you begin compressions. A minute conserved is a better forecaster of survival than almost any type of various other aspect you control.
If you are accountable for an AED at your website, established a regular monthly tip to inspect the condition light, pads expiry, and battery date. The majority of devices do a self‑test and show environment-friendly when prepared, amber or red if a mistake exists. Maintain spare pads available if you can. If you have kids on site, ask your supplier regarding pediatric pads or a kid mode switch.
Common anxiety factors, and exactly how training addresses them
Many first‑timers say they bother with breaking ribs throughout CPR. It can happen, specifically with older individuals, and it is not a reason to quit. Fitness instructors will certainly show you how to place your hands and shoulders to reduce injury danger and increase blood circulation. If a rib splits, you keep going.
Another problem is legal exposure. Australia's Good Samaritan securities cover people who act in great confidence within their degree of training. Trainers in Tuggerah will discuss when to move a person, when to quit, and just how to turn over to paramedics. You will practise giving a brief, structured handover so ambulance teams can pick up without wasting time.
Students also worry regarding doing something "wrong" and making things even worse. The fact is that doing nothing when faced with no breathing is the worst alternative. Quality training demystifies the actions and gives you a script, so you can concentrate on the individual, not your nerves.
